Test Water Stress Levels
After confirming your hose pipes and fittings are cost-free of splits, it's time to check the water stress degrees in your automatic sprinkler. Beginning by affixing a stress scale to an outdoor faucet. Activate the water completely and keep in mind the pressure analysis. Ideally, you want a stress in between 30 and 50 psi for peak efficiency. Check for obstructions in your hose pipes or emitters if the pressure is as well reduced. You may require to readjust your stress regulatory authority if it's also high. Keep in mind, excessive pressure can lead to leakages and inefficient watering. Check the Controller and Timers
Evaluating the controller and timers of your lawn sprinkler system is vital for keeping an effective sprinkling timetable. Make sure the day and time are proper; this warranties your system runs as intended.
Run a hands-on examination cycle for every zone to confirm it activates properly. See for any type of breakdowns or delays, as these can show concerns needing interest. Readjust the run times and frequency if you see any type of zones more than- or under-watered.
Likewise, familiarize on your own with the rainfall delay attribute if your controller has one; it aids save water during wet periods. Regularly checking your controller and timers not only conserves water yet also promotes healthier plants and a vibrant landscape.
Clean Filters and Screens
Consistently cleansing screens and filters is critical for keeping your lawn sprinkler system operating effectively. Over time, mineral, debris, and dust build-up can block these components, leading to irregular water distribution and decreased performance. Start by finding more info the filters and displays in your system, which are typically found at the major line and private lawn sprinkler heads.
As soon as you've recognized them, transform off the water and thoroughly eliminate each filter or display. Rinse them under running water to displace any kind of accumulation. For stubborn down payments, use a soft brush and light cleaning agent, yet avoid extreme chemicals that might damage the components.
After cleaning, reassemble everything and double-check for any kind of noticeable wear or damage. Readjust Pressure Regulator
Adjusting the stress regulator is necessary for preserving optimal water pressure in your sprinkler system. Start by examining the pressure scale to see if it's within the suggested variety for your system. It's time to make modifications if the reading is also high or too reduced. Locate the stress regulatory authority, normally found near the water resource. You'll typically find a screw or knob for changes. Turn it clockwise to reduce the pressure or counterclockwise to boost it, depending upon your scale analysis. After making changes, run the system for a few mins and reconsider the scale.
